Heads up, support folks: the Wayfinder tile prefetcher is failing its CI smoke test again because the mock tile server in the Pellam staging cluster returns empty bundles after midnight restarts. Customers reporting blank map regions are hitting the same stale cache, not a real outage. Tell them to force-refresh; the fix ships with the next Cartwheel release. The build you'll want to reference is right below.

session token of bawep-yadup = htk21_528abd376e3c5a4ec24a1

## Runbook: Liftwise simulator restart

Quick one for the sync — if the Liftwise dispatch sim starts queueing phantom cars, bounce the `dispatchd` worker and clear `/tmp/liftwise/state`. Check that `SIM_FLOORS=40` matches the Marrow Tower profile before restarting. The sim won't reconnect to the event bus without its token, so drop that in on the next line.

secret setting of fawep-tagaf: ARCHIVE_KEY3=ce5

Subject: Handover — tracing

Quiet shift. Span loss between Ordley checkout and the Vexa payments service is back; sampler config suspected, not fixed. Trace IDs still propagate fine through the gateway. Dashboards updated, nothing paging. If the collector backs up again, restart it once, then escalate to the observability team at the address below.

escalation mailbox, yajeg-bageg: quenax.olidor@lumiccorp.internal

Ticket: Unlock migration vault for Ironvine ORM refactor

New team members: the legacy Ironvine ORM layer is being replaced module by module, and the schema snapshots needed for safe refactoring sit in a locked vault nobody has opened since the last owner left. We recovered the credentials from escrow this week. The passphrase follows below.

unlock words, kajog-yawip: istwyn-casath-aldok

Vendor note for new team members: canary gating on the Bramblewick platform is enforced by our vendor, Opaline Systems, not by us. Their Gatewright tool holds each canary at 5% traffic until error rate, latency p95, and saturation all pass for 30 minutes. We cannot override the hold; only Opaline's release desk can. Document any gating dispute in the vendor log before requesting an exception. For exception requests, write to their release desk directly.

alerts address for bahaf-kaduf: zorox@qorvelio.internal